The University of Georgia Bulldogs’ football program has been the subject of significant media attention, with multiple documentaries highlighting their recent successes. Notably, ESPN produced “Them Dawgs,” a documentary focusing on the Bulldogs’ 2022 national championship season. This film offers an in-depth look at the team’s journey, featuring game highlights, player interviews, and exclusive behind-the-scenes footage from locker rooms and sidelines. “Them Dawgs” premiered on SEC Network on July 17, 2023, and is also available for streaming on ESPN+.

In contrast, Netflix has announced an upcoming college football docuseries set to release in the summer of 2025. This eight-episode series will provide behind-the-scenes coverage of Southeastern Conference (SEC) teams throughout the 2024 football season. However, the University of Georgia has chosen not to participate in this particular documentary. Other SEC schools, including Alabama, Texas, and Oklahoma, have also opted out. Consequently, the series will primarily focus on teams such as Arkansas, Auburn, Florida, Kentucky, LSU, Mississippi State,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as A&M, and Vanderbilt.
